Output 718cb6c7513e1cf66894aaa21574a61bbd852bd7099152e110af470fa1d57c25:1

value
3024957701
script pubkey
OP_0 OP_PUSHBYTES_20 8fe83013683a4244c19d75564344e38a5863755d
address
tb1q3l5rqymg8fpyfsvaw4tyx38r3fvxxa2aaw0j4s
transaction
718cb6c7513e1cf66894aaa21574a61bbd852bd7099152e110af470fa1d57c25
confirmations
106055
spent
true